Understanding Your Water Source

Your water source plays a significant role in determining the type of water filter you need. If you’re using tap water, you may need a filter that can remove chlorine, heavy metals, and other contaminants commonly found in tap water. On the other hand, if you’re using well water or rainwater, you may need a filter that can remove b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ms.

You can start by getting your water tested to determine the types of contaminants present, and then choose a filter that is designed to remove those specific contaminants. This will help you narrow down your options and find the best water filters for Vietnam that meet your specific needs.

Filter Type and Technology

There are many different types of water filters available, each with its own unique technology and benefits. You may choose from activated carbon filters, reverse osmosis filters, ultraviolet (UV) filters, or a combination of these technologies.

You should consider the specific contaminants you want to remove and the flow rate you need, as well as the space and installation requirements. Some filters may be more suitable for small households or apartments, while others may be better suited for larger homes or commercial use.

What types of water filters are available for use in Vietnam?

You can choose from a variety of water filters in Vietnam, including activated carbon filters, ceramic filters, and reverse osmosis (RO) filters. Activated carbon filters are effective in removing chlorine, taste, and odor from water, while ceramic filters can remove bacteria, viruses, and parasites. RO filters, on the other hand, use a semipermeable membrane to remove dissolved solids, heavy metals, and other impurities from water.

When selecting a water filter for use in Vietnam, consider the specific contaminants you want to remove from your water. If you are concerned about bacteria, viruses, and parasites, a ceramic or RO filter may be the best option. If you are looking to improve the taste and odor of your water, an activated carbon filter may be sufficient. Your water filter needs will also depend on the source of your water, so it is essential to have your water tested before selecting a filter.

Can I use a water filter to remove fluoride from my drinking water in Vietnam?

Some water filters can remove fluoride from drinking water, but not all filters are created equal. Activated carbon filters, for example, are not effective in removing fluoride from water. However, some reverse osmosis (RO) filters and distillation systems can remove up to 90% of fluoride from water. You should check the specifications of any filter you are considering to ensure it can remove fluoride.

If you are concerned about fluoride in your drinking water, you may want to consider a filter specifically designed to remove this contaminant. Some filters use activated alumina or other media that can selectively remove fluoride from water. When shopping for a water filter to remove fluoride, look for a filter that has been certified to remove this contaminant and follow the manufacturer’s maintenance and replacement instructions to ensure optimal performance.

How often should I replace my water filter in Vietnam?

The frequency of replacing your water filter in Vietnam depends on the type of filter you have and how much water you use. Most water filters have a recommended replacement schedule, which can range from a few months to a year or more. Activated carbon filters, for example, typically need to be replaced every 3-6 months, while RO filters may need to be replaced every 6-12 months.

You should also monitor your water filter’s performance and replace it if you notice a decrease in water flow or an increase in contaminants. Some water filters have indicators that show when they need to be replaced, while others require regular testing to ensure they are functioning properly. Replacing your water filter regularly will help ensure you have access to clean and safe drinking water and prevent contaminants from building up in your filter.
